Abstract
Aacharya Sushrut, father of surgery has considered arsha
(haemorrhoid) in ashtamahagada[1] as it significantly disturbs the
activities of body like an enemy. Masses of tissue consist of muscles
and elastic fibres with swollen, inflamed vasculature along with
supported surrounding tissues around the anal canal are haemorrhoids
or piles. They are mainly divided into two groups i.e. External and
Internal haemorrhoids. It is a common disease of anal canal. According
to ayurveda, mandagni is the main aetiological factor for arsha.
Acharya charak stated that vitiated doshas follow bahya and
abhyantar rogmarga to produce arsha.[2] Acharya sushrut believed
that arsha as rakta-mansa pradoshaj vyadhi.[3] Jalauka can be used as successful tool in this
situation by relieving venous pooling of blood and also by liquefying the clotted blood in pile
mass. In present study; a patient of 2nd degree internal haemorrhoid cured by
jalaukavacharana. It concluded in remarkable benefit in re-establishment of circulation and
marked reduction in pain, tenderness and swelling of haemorrhoids and thus it was concluded
that jalaukavacharana is one of the best and important tool in management of 2nd degree
internal haemorrhoids.
